In this unique lecture from 1958, Dr. Ehrenfried Pfeiffer - close collaborator of Rudolf Steiner and a key figure in biodynamic research - sheds brilliant light on the delicate balance between the forces that elevate life and those that decompose form.

Starting from the physiology of plants and humans, Pfeiffer demonstrates how light, heat, and metabolism connect the physical with the superphysical, while electricity, radioactivity, and mechanical forces belong to the subphysical world – the realm beneath life.

Through scientific examples, personal conversations with Steiner, and bold perspectives on the future of humanity, one of the most critical issues of our time is highlighted: the quality of protein, the weakening of ethereal forces, and the need for a new understanding of nutrition and metabolism.

This text presents one of Pfeiffer's most important spiritual-scientific positions, showing that human life is not determined solely by chemistry but by the forces that transform matter into a vessel of consciousness.

A book that opens horizons and invites us to recognize our responsibility towards life – on Earth, in plants, and in humanity itself.
